Synthesis, Photophysics, and Potential Antifungal Activity of Benzo[<i>a</i>]phenoxazines
The synthesis and full characterization of new hydroxyl benzo[<i>a</i>]phenoxazinium chlorides with <i>N</i>-(di)propyl and/or <i>N</i>-isopropyl groups in the 5 and 9 positions are described. Photophysical studies carried out in ethanol and water revealed strong...
